Utility and Adoption
Ethereum, the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, has experienced significant volatility, presenting both opportunities and challenges for investors. Understanding the underlying dynamics driving Ethereum's price is crucial for navigating this complex landscape and making informed decisions. This summary delves into recent trends, analyzes key factors influencing Ethereum's value, and explores potential future projections.
One of the primary factors impacting Ethereum's price is its utility. Beyond being a cryptocurrency, Ethereum serves as a decentralized platform for a wide range of applications, including decentralized finance (DeFi), non-fungible tokens (NFTs), and dec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s). The increasing adoption of these applications directly correlates with the demand for Ether (ETH), the native cryptocurrency of the Ethereum network. As more developers and users utilize the Ethereum blockchain, the inherent value of ETH tends to appreciate.
Network Congestion and Ethereum 2.0
However, this utility is not without its constraints. Network congestion and high transaction fees, often referred to as "gas fees," have historically plagued the Ethereum network, particularly during periods of high demand. These high fees can deter users from engaging with DeFi protocols and other applications, ultimately impacting the demand for ETH and potentially suppressing its price. The highly anticipated Ethereum 2.0 upgrade, with its transition to a proof-of-stake (PoS) consensus mechanism and the implementation of sharding, aims to address these scalability issues and reduce gas fees. The successful completion of these upgrades is seen as a critical catalyst for future price appreciation.
Proof-of-Stake Transition
The transition to proof-of-stake has already had a significant impact. The Beacon Chain, the foundation of Ethereum 2.0, is already live, and the Merge, which combined the Beacon Chain with the existing Ethereum mainnet, has been successfully completed. This move to PoS not only reduces energy consumption but also introduces staking as a means of earning rewards by validating transactions. The amount of ETH staked on the Beacon Chain has consistently increased, reducing the circulating supply and potentially exerting upward pressure on the price. The staking yield also presents an attractive incentive for long-term holders.

Decentralized Finance (DeFi)
The rise of Decentralized Finance (DeFi) has been intrinsically linked to Ethereum's price trajectory. DeFi protocols, built on the Ethereum blockchain, offer a range of financial services, including lending, borrowing, and decentralized exchanges. The total value locked (TVL) in DeFi protocols is a key indicator of the health and adoption of the DeFi ecosystem. A growing TVL suggests increased user engagement and confidence in DeFi, which in turn can positively impact the demand for ETH, as it is often used as collateral and gas for these protocols.
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s)
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) have also contributed significantly to Ethereum's price dynamics. NFTs, unique digital assets representing ownership of items such as art, collectibles, and virtual real estate, are primarily minted and traded on the Ethereum blockchain. The NFT market experienced explosive growth, driving significant demand for ETH as users needed it to purchase and transact with NFTs. While the NFT market has cooled down somewhat, it remains a significant part of the Ethereum ecosystem and continues to influence its price.

Risks and Challenges
Conversely, several risks could potentially hinder Ethereum's price growth. Regulatory uncertainty remains a significant concern, as governments around the world grapple with how to regulate cryptocurrencies. Security vulnerabilities in DeFi protocols could lead to significant losses and erode investor confidence. Competition from other blockchain platforms, such as Solana, Cardano, and Binance Smart Chain, could also challenge Ethereum's dominance and limit its price potential. Furthermore, macroeconomic factors, such as inflation and interest rate hikes, can impact the broader cryptocurrency market and negatively affect Ethereum's price.
